Kylian Mbappé has reached 14 career goals in FIFA World Cup tournaments, exceeding the totals of football legends Pelé and Lionel Messi. With this achievement, Mbappé is now among the top goalscorers in World Cup history. He is rapidly approaching the all-time record of 16 goals, currently held by Miroslav Klose. Analysts predict Mbappé will likely surpass Klose’s record in the current or future tournaments. This milestone further solidifies Mbappé’s position as a dominant force in international football.
